Media
Convertir plusieurs fichiers WAV vers les formats MP3, OGG, AAC, M4A, OPUS et FLAC avec réglages de qualité, contrôle du débit binaire et traitement par lot
Appelez cet outil depuis votre code en trois langages.
# 1) Upload each file first → returns { filePath }
curl -X POST 'https://api.elysiatools.com/upload/batch-wav-converter' \
-F 'file=@/path/to/wavFiles.ext'
# 2) Call the tool with the returned filePath values
curl -X POST 'https://api.elysiatools.com/fr/api/tools/batch-wav-converter' \
-F 'wavFiles=/path/to/file.ext' \
-F 'outputFormat=mp3' \
-F 'bitrate=e.g., 128k, 192k, 320k (optional)' \
-F 'quality=5' \
-F 'sampleRate=auto' \
-F 'channels=auto' \
-F 'preserveMetadata=true' \
-F 'keepOriginalNames=true'Envoyez une requête POST avec vos entrées en JSON. Les paramètres de type fichier nécessitent un upload préalable.
POST https://api.elysiatools.com/fr/api/tools/batch-wav-converter| Nom | Type | Requis | Description |
|---|---|---|---|
| wavFiles | fileupload requis | Oui | — |
| outputFormat | select | Oui | — |
| bitrate | text | Non | — |
| quality | number | Non | — |
| sampleRate | select | Non | — |
| channels | select | Non | — |
| preserveMetadata | checkbox | Non | — |
| keepOriginalNames | checkbox | Non | Conserver les noms de fichiers d'origine. Les doublons seront automatiquement renommés avec un suffixe. |
Résultat fichier
{
"filePath": "/public/processing/randomid.ext",
"fileName": "output.ext",
"contentType": "application/octet-stream",
"size": 1024,
"metadata": {
"key": "value"
},
"error": "Error message (optional)",
"message": "Notification message (optional)"
}Ajoutez cet outil à votre serveur Model Context Protocol pour que les agents IA puissent le lister et l'appeler.
Ajoutez ce bloc à la configuration de votre client MCP :
{
"mcpServers": {
"elysiatools-batch-wav-converter": {
"name": "batch-wav-converter",
"description": "Convertir plusieurs fichiers WAV vers les formats MP3, OGG, AAC, M4A, OPUS et FLAC avec réglages de qualité, contrôle du débit binaire et traitement par lot",
"baseUrl": "https://api.elysiatools.com/mcp/sse?toolId=batch-wav-converter",
"command": "",
"args": [],
"env": {},
"isActive": true,
"type": "sse"
}
}
}Après connexion au point d'accès SSE, listez les outils exposés :
{
"jsonrpc": "2.0",
"id": 1,
"method": "tools/list"
}Appelez l'outil par son id ; les arguments sont construits à partir de ses paramètres :
{
"jsonrpc": "2.0",
"id": 2,
"method": "tools/call",
"params": {
"name": "batch-wav-converter",
"arguments": {
"wavFiles": "https://example.com/file.ext",
"outputFormat": "mp3",
"bitrate": "e.g., 128k, 192k, 320k (optional)",
"quality": 5,
"sampleRate": "auto",
"channels": "auto",
"preserveMetadata": true,
"keepOriginalNames": true
}
}
}Des questions ou un problème ? Contactez [email protected]